What is STAAD.Pro??

Introduction

  • STAAD Pro is a structural design oriented program with a user interactive interface which allows for the user working on it extremely easy.
  • It can be used for modelling, designing and analyzing various structures and structural configurations.
  • STAAD Pro programming is broadly utilized as a part of the structural analysis and designing structures – towers, buildings, bridges, transportation facilities, utility and industrial structures. Designs can include building structures incorporating culverts, petrochemical plants, bridges, tunnels, piles; and construction materials such as timber, steel, concrete, aluminum and cold-formed steel.
  • It is extremely useful for buildings and other such structures insignificant of their uses varying from residential to commercial to hospitals to offices. This software can be used for all kinds of buildings of various architectural drawings under a plethora of loads.
  • Other than buildings, it is also useful for bridges to some extent and also foundation design and analysis. Shear wall is another feature incorporated into it for design facilitation. Steel buildings and connections can also be designed and successfully rendered to view the real-life resembling images for detailed clarity.

Advantage of using Staad Pro Software :

  • Faster method of designing the structure.
  • Does not involve any manual calculation.
  • Suitable for almost all types material for designing i. e. Concrete, Steel, Aluminium etc.
  • Shows accuracy in results i.e. Shear Force, Bending moment diagram for each and every beam and column of the structure. That you were doing manualy.
  • Shows result for Number of reinforcement used longitudanaly, Shear reinforcement.
  • Helps you to make improvement in structure, section, dimensions.
  • You can design structure for any type of load i. e. Dead load, Live load, wind load, snow load, area load, floor load etc.
  • You can design simple beam to sky scraper and analyse wheather it will fail at applied load or pass.
  • You can import designs from auto CAD to staad.
  • Easy to learn.

Limitations:

  • Not for brick masonary work.
  • Does not show the amount of material used.
  • Not for costing and estimating.
  • Require proper skill for typical designs.
  • And few other.
